Over time, the average size of stay for inpatient mental well being care is having shorter. In 2018, the normal keep for Grown ups while in the U.S. lasted among 5 and 7 times. Extensive-time period clinic admissions that lasted weeks used to be program decades ago but are now uncommon.

In California, psychiatric units will need to have a minimal nurse-to-patient ratio of 1 to six. Some states obtain and publish details about hospital staffing ratios. You may as well find out how a device is staffed by contacting the unit and asking.
